Ticket: Vault sealed — Corvex public REST API. Pagination cursors are failing to sign because the cursor-signing vault auto-locked after three failed health probes. Symptom: all paginated endpoints return 500 past page one. Mitigation: unseal the vault on node two, restart the cursor service, confirm signed cursors in the smoke test. No schema changes needed. Unseal prompt on the node will request the passphrase that follows.

recovery phrase for bawef-kagug: casix-tamvan-lamath-holeth-gilmir-drudor-julax-wenok-wenael-rusvan-holax-goriel-frawyn

## Deploying the Gatewick Proctor Queue

Deploys are pretty painless: push to main, wait for the pipeline, then watch the queue drain dashboard for five minutes. If candidates pile up mid-exam, roll back first and ask questions later — the queue replays safely. Everything the workers care about lives in one config block, shown here for reference.

settings of bafof-yagef:
JOROX_PIN=8740
JOROX_TENANT=pelox
JOROX_METRICS_HOST=metrics.jorox.qorvelworks.internal
JOROX_SEAL=seal_c78f63c1
JOROX_STANDBY_TEAM=norax

**14:22 — Calendar sync conflict detected (Meridel Suite)**

The Tallowfield scheduling service began rejecting sync pushes after two clients submitted overlapping edits to the same recurring event series. Affected users saw duplicate entries for roughly 40 minutes. On-call rolled back the conflict-resolution change and replayed queued updates. Support should reference the replay batch when responding to tickets; the trace token for that batch follows.

session token of fawep-tajep = htk14_4221f8eaf43a2f

Handover — Vexler partner SFTP drop

Ownership moves to you today. Drop runs hourly from Vexler's end into the intake bucket via the relay host. Watch for zero-byte files; their exporter flakes on Mondays. Creds live in the ops vault, path noted in the runbook. Vault auto-seals after 48h idle. Support escalations go to the on-call rotation, not me. If the vault is sealed when you need it, unseal with the recovery passphrase below.

recovery phrase for tadug-fafof: zorwyn-kasion